From: Peter Brawley Date: December 4 2005 10:41pm Subject: Re: parse error creating table List-Archive: http://lists.mysql.com/mysql/192502 Message-Id: <439370B3.70504@earthlink.net> M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=ISO-8859-1; format=flowed Content-Transfer-Encoding: 7bit Ferindo One problem is: employment_status_id INTEGER REFERENCES employment_statuses(id) NOT NULL, NOT NULL should be before REFERENCES. Also, in: last_updated TIMESTAMP DEFAULT CURRENT_TIMESTAMP NOT NULL, (i) NOT NULL is superfluous since the default is given by CURRENT_TIMESTAMP. (ii) specifying DEFAULT CURRENT_TIMESTAMP defeats auto-resetting of the timestamp on updates. Is that what you want? To get auto-setting on INSERTs and UPDATEs, just write last_updated TIMESTAMP, Also the manual doesn't mention TIME WITHOUT TIME ZONE. Are you thinking of PostgreSQL?
